1. Understanding Drostanolone Enanthate
Drostanolone Enanthate is a well-known anabolic steroid often utilized in cutting cycles. It provides muscle preservation and enhances physical conditioning. Notably, it is less prone to aromatization compared to other steroids, making it an attractive option for athletes looking to maintain a lean physique.
2. The Role of Peptides
Peptides serve as short chains of amino acids, and they play a vital role in various biological functions. In bodybuilding, certain peptides can stimulate growth hormone release, aid in recovery, and enhance fat burning. Commonly utilized peptides include:
- GHRP-6: Promotes growth hormone release and enhances appetite.
- IGF-1: Supports muscle growth and repair, particularly during calorie deficits.
- CJC-1295: Stimulates natural growth hormone release for greater muscle gains.
